1936 - Spanish Civil War: Nationalist Re-Establishment of Bi-Color Flag, Spanish Civil War 15Aug36 High angle, Church exterior w/ crowds as icon carried thru streets. La Giralda Tower & bells ringing. 20:24:43 Statue of virgin seen past heads of monks & Spanish Civil War soldier w/ rifle. Soldiers standing, but laughing. Altar boys & men in black shirts giving fascist salute. Flags in background. Officers & others. Enormous crowd. 20:25:25 High angle of crowded street & many people on balconies. Girls in uniforms; boys in uniforms w/ fascist salute; army soldiers marching past include Moroccans (?). 20:26:10 Generals watching. Sevilla Town Hall balcony w/ Falangist shield; General Gonzalo Queipo De Llano speaking & gesturing. Possibly General Franco on right. Large bi-color Spanish flag unfurled. Crowd below looking up. 20:26:54 Old fortress-like building w/ window glass broken out. Embassy (?) crest on iron railing, flag above. Hole in end from shelling. Other heavy damage to roof of a building. 20:27:16 Workmen removing timbers & bricks from destroyed houses or shops.
